Find the special solution of the differential equation 4Y "- 12Y '+ 9y = 0 satisfying the initial conditions y ▏ y = 0 = 1, y' ▏ x = 0 = 1 The comma above is an apostrophe

The characteristic equation is 4R ^ 2-12r + 9 = 0, r = 3 / 2
So y = e ^ (3x / 2) (c1x + C2)
y'=e^(3x/2)(3C1/2*x+3C2/2+C1)
Let x = 0
1=C2,1=3C2/2+C1
The solution is C1 = - 1 / 2, C2 = 1
So y = e ^ (3x / 2) (- X / 2 + 1)
